I'm Hungarian, and here is a small correction: "Hazánk része, Kárpátalja köszöntünk!" isn't "Welcome to Transcarpathia, part of our country!" instead, it's "Part of our country, Transcarpathia, we welcome you!", almost as if the singer is talking to Transcarpathia itself. The rest of the translation is perfect :)
As another Hungarian, I would say "Part of our homeland" would be a more fitting expression than "Part of our country" but otherwise yes, you're right.

@@ThirdHetmanateArmy What did Hungary do? I'm not familiar with this
@@weetbix4497 He refers to the fact that we've handed over a few hundred (500-600) members of the "Carpatian Sich" milita - most of them had Polish citizenship, as they came from Galicia - to the Poles, and a day after were promptly shot by the Poles for treason. Additionally we've summarily executed a small number of Sich Guardsmen, who did not carry any insignia or other marks of identification as partizans.
I don't know too much about the legality of the former, but it seems logical that the Polish laws of the the era forbade any Polish citizen to serve in any foreign armed formation, but the latter was well within our rights, according to the Hague and Geneva conventions.
